WebDec 31, 2024 · If Tableau is not identifying the field as a date type, right click on the field in the left-hand pane, and select Change Data Type and select Date. To get the short date format, right click on the field in the left-hand pane, and select Default Properties -> Date Format. If you need to use DATEPARSE, here is an example:
